You couldn’t miss James in the audience for Adele’s One Night Only concert last week in LA (he was also a producer), but it was Emma Thompson, THE Nanny McPhee, who was acting a fool and “this my jam!”-ing all over the place like your favorite fun drunk auntie at a wedding.

Eyes — closed, rapturously. Hands — thrown in the air without a care. Mouth — singing along to Rolling In The Deep with wild abandon. Here’s Emma reminding her countrymen that this is a concert, not a fucking tea party.

Not only was Emma threatening Flava Flav’s bag as hype-man extraordinaire, she also had a special surprise for Adele. According to Huffington Post, during this concert, “instead of being interviewed by Oprah Winfrey, this time, Adele was quizzed by members of her celebrity guest list.” Emma asked her “if she had someone who inspired and supported her when she was younger,” and Adele answered, without hesitation, “Yeah, I had a teacher at Chestnut Grove [Academy] who taught me English. That was Miss McDonald.

That’s when Thompson announced that Miss McDonald was present, and she made her way up to the stage to see her former pupil. After a tearful embrace, the two had a brief catchup.

Here’s Emma presenting Adele with a beloved mentor instead of a wad of ABC gum like someone else we know.
